This isn’t something new it’s been around in the auto industry for decades, way back in the day you would have to run the wiring if a customer purchased a towing package, they changed that over time by basically having the wire harnesses pre wired and instead you would just add a couple of plug and play components, the newest versions of this is software unlocks, they just got rid of the actual hardware stuff
